Transaction 76d96a6b29ee5e2d0a701bc6fc3282246b7d71a95cc2e76d6cd7684e8bee30f3

1 Input
2 Outputs
  • 76d96a6b29ee5e2d0a701bc6fc3282246b7d71a95cc2e76d6cd7684e8bee30f3:0
  • value  28713086
    address  3MiG334nEEmVA14B48h2hKk7mxEkJR5ukj
  • 76d96a6b29ee5e2d0a701bc6fc3282246b7d71a95cc2e76d6cd7684e8bee30f3:1
  • value  151588691
    address  3BWLibYhPjjfX4LKj5F4K75GvwJhBZhHUj